Hadrian. AD 117-138. Æ As (27.5mm, 15.47 g, 6h). Rome mint. Struck circa AD 124-128. Laureate bust right, slight drapery / Salus standing left, holding scepter and feeding from patera a serpent coiled around and rising from altar. RIC II 678 var. (no drapery). VF, dark brown patina, minor roughness.
